The Cactus Wren found yesterday by Joey Kellner continues at the corner of
CR 193.5 north of Kim in Las Animas County (37.636408,-103.431881). I heard
the bird sing from due east of the corner six or seven times at about 5:20
this morning and got an audio recording. It sounded like it was within 100
yards of the road but I couldn't see it. It then sounded like it moved
farther east. I suspect the corner is near the west end of its area. Other
people have arrived to search for the bird so hopefully they will manage to
locate it. I searched the spot from 7:00 pm to sunset last night without
any success.
Be advised that the mockingbird that sings persistently south of the corner
has picked up some Cactus Wren song and can cause momentary confusion.
